本文整理汇总了Python中MySQLdb.version_info方法的典型用法代码示例。如果您正苦于以下问题:Python MySQLdb.version_info方法的具体用法?Python MySQLdb.version_info怎么用?Python MySQLdb.version_info使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类MySQLdb
的用法示例。
在下文中一共展示了MySQLdb.version_info方法的2个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Python代码示例。
示例1: get_summary
# 需要导入模块: import MySQLdb [as 别名]
# 或者: from MySQLdb import version_info [as 别名]
def get_summary(cls):
"""
Return a diction of information about this database
backend.
"""
summary = {
"DB-API version": "2.0",
"Database SQL type": cls.__name__,
"Database SQL module": "MySQLdb",
"Database SQL module version": ".".join([str(v) for v in MySQLdb.version_info]),
"Database SQL module location": MySQLdb.__file__,
}
return summary
示例2: test_quote_value
# 需要导入模块: import MySQLdb [as 别名]
# 或者: from MySQLdb import version_info [as 别名]
def test_quote_value(self):
import MySQLdb
editor = connection.schema_editor()
tested_values = [
('string', "'string'"),
(42, '42'),
(1.754, '1.754e0' if MySQLdb.version_info >= (1, 3, 14) else '1.754'),
(False, b'0' if MySQLdb.version_info >= (1, 4, 0) else '0'),
]
for value, expected in tested_values:
with self.subTest(value=value):
self.assertEqual(editor.quote_value(value), expected)